Analysis
Yemen recorded 41,735 1000 Int$ for oranges — gross production value in 2024.
The figure is up 0.2% on the previous year and up 6.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, oranges — gross production value in Yemen peaked at 54,191 1000 Int$ in 2003 and was at its lowest, 797 1000 Int$, in 1981.
That places Yemen 35th out of 117 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
